2013-06-29 3 views
1

На некоторых страницах веб-сайта, когда я пытаюсь открыть «Просмотр источника» с помощью google chrome и проверять скрытые значения, я обнаружил, что пуст, но когда я проверяю форма, я могу реально увидеть содержимое этого скрытого значения,HTML/Javascript получить переменную на загрузку страницы

, например, this site, когда я пытаюсь проверить источник я не могу увидеть значение nid, Я думаю, что это что-то делать с этой функцией,

<script type="text/javascript"> 
    function upuid(a){ 
     $('input[name="nid"]').val(a) 
    } 
</script> 

, но я не могу найти, где он называется, и что такое параметр a э.

спасибо.

ответ

1

На странице источника страницы просмотра отображается точный текст, который был возвращен сервером. Элемент «Inspect» фактически показывает вам полностью обработанное дерево DOM.

0

Значение устанавливается с клиентской стороны. Вот почему вы не можете видеть это в источнике. Я предполагаю, что метод get вызван из https://www.clixsense.com/uid.swf через ExternalInterface.call. «A» - это строка, и в этом случае это уникальный идентификатор.

Смежные вопросы